Transaction 57ee30aa81fc4be4a552037487531770d7ef6aada0c22174d09ca87cd264cf18

1 Input
2 Outputs
  • 57ee30aa81fc4be4a552037487531770d7ef6aada0c22174d09ca87cd264cf18:0
  • value  1534904
    address  15WWh9HQjGqZAjMEVk842MMWbuTosqhbCP
  • 57ee30aa81fc4be4a552037487531770d7ef6aada0c22174d09ca87cd264cf18:1
  • value  442880717
    address  37cELazd3buqtm7jqHUfh1okzfivm242GY